    Admittedly, this is not a specific AS issue. But I know some people are using URL Master with AS and hopefully some have upgraded to DNN 5.5.

    I did the DNN 5.5 upgrade and did not see any noticeable issues until I tried to add a module to a page and got an error. I am not going to present all of my research here, but apparently there was an issue with URL Master and DNN 5.5. A new version of URL Master is available for DNN 5.5. compatibility, but it suggests upgrading URL Master before DNN 5.5. Well that is too late for me.

    I actually found this issue on another site I upgraded that used URL Master. So I am just curious if anyone has run up against this and how they resolved it. My site is not live, and I have good backups. So I can restore, upgrade URL Master and then do DNN 5.5 upgrade. But I thought I would just broach the subject here and see is anyone has ideas or has experienced this issue.

    Cliff,

    I did not see your reply until today so please excuse me for the delay. Have you figured this out yet? I am sure you have by now. Anyway, I was able to upgrade url master after I had already upgraded my DNN website. The only issue I had was adding new modules to the pages.

    You can try commenting out url master from the web.config and then access the pages and remove the module all together. Then install it again? Please do the backup first. My friend once told me that real men do not backup their websites but they also cry a lot for not doing it. :)

    I ended up doing a quick restore of my PRE DNN 5.5 backup. Then I did the URL Master upgrade. Then I did the DNN 5.5 upgrade and everything seems to be working correctly. Hope this helps others.
